Output 6ec3c260b92ee06ba2007bda3265a6d9686b72171cffc8df246c7ca8adb218fe:2

value
78350000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 75bf135061df9ced905288e8f27f6c40f40520c2 OP_EQUAL
address
3CRbt9DxFVpZVBZAY4aVkDtrwwinDgF6yd
transaction
6ec3c260b92ee06ba2007bda3265a6d9686b72171cffc8df246c7ca8adb218fe
spent
true